Latest Patents
Dirk Fries holds 1 patent for his invention titled "Lubricant compositions containing beta-glucans." This patent describes a lubricant composition that includes at least one beta-glucan, optionally in the form of one of its derivatives, along with at least one base oil and at least one additive component. The invention aims to reduce wear in metal-on-metal contact and decrease the friction coefficient of lubricant compositions.
